Hidden by the tourist-trap fountains outside the Centre Pompidou and the bars that surround them, the Eglise Saint-Merry is worth hunting out in order to discover its architecture and cultural programmes. Since 1975 the Accueil Libre association (entirely funded by financial and artistic donations) has put on two concerts here a week – the perfect opportunity to discover the interior of this magnificent, flamboyant gothic edifice.

Entry is free, so there's no reason not to wander the nave and admire the stained glass to the strains of some classical music – though if Bach or Rachmaninov aren't your thing, look out for occasional appearances by Armenian, Chinese, Indian, jazz and rock music on the programme.
